Output e93ea8c7c3bcd347c4aa63cbc8f9391e0e387d3af53c105ee74919e1d8945f02:4

value
108012923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f64e99b2b032f0a38fcbc3a0562887cee4f5df26 OP_EQUAL
address
MWMWcsTfRwoGufc1L5Qm7rqCMVJNuniRCY
transaction
e93ea8c7c3bcd347c4aa63cbc8f9391e0e387d3af53c105ee74919e1d8945f02
spent
true